Visual Indicators of Termite Invasion



If you notice little stacks of what appears like sawdust near wooden frameworks in your house, you may be seeing the initial visual indications of a termite infestation. https://www.upr.org/arts-and-culture/2020-01-29/wild-animals-are-not-pets , frequently described as the 'quiet destroyers,' can wreak havoc on your property without you even recognizing it. These tiny piles are actually termite droppings, referred to as frass, which are a result of their tunneling tasks within the wood.

As you examine your home for indicators of termites, pay close attention to any type of mud tubes leaving the wall surfaces or structure. These tubes work as protective tunnels for termites to take a trip between their nest and a food resource without drying. Additionally, keep an eye out for any type of bubbling or peeling off paint, as this might suggest wetness accumulation triggered by termite task within the walls.

Structural Adjustments Caused by Termites



Pay attention very closely for any type of indications of hollow-sounding or deteriorated timber in your home, as these architectural adjustments could indicate a termite infestation. Termites feed on timber from the inside out, leaving a slim veneer of lumber or paint on the surface while hollowing out the inside. This can lead to timber that appears hollow when touched or feels soft and damaged.

Additionally, you may see buckling or drooping floors, doors that no more close correctly, or home windows that are instantly tough to open. These modifications occur as termites damage the structural honesty of wooden components in your home. Keep an eye out for tiny holes in wood, as these could be termite departure factors where they push out fecal pellets.
